Newquay Activity Centre is an award-winning surf school and watersports centre based at 60 Fore Street in the heart of Newquay, Cornwall. Founded in 1996, it is one of the UK's longest-running surf schools, offering surf lessons, coasteering, kayaking, stand-up paddleboarding, bodyboarding, snorkelling and coastal adventure tours operating from Towan Beach and Fistral Beach. Family sessions (Age 3+) include Family Surf Lessons, Family Super SUP, Family Kayak Tours and Family Bodyboard Lessons; most public group activities suit ages 8+. All equipment (wetsuits, boards, safety gear) is included in the session price, and instructors are ISA Surf Coach qualified and SLSGB trained. Winner of multiple Cornwall Tourism Awards, South West Tourism Awards and TripAdvisor Travellers' Choice awards.
